Video Accessory IC Series
For portable image equipment
Upscaler IC
BU1521GVW
No.09069EAT02
â Description
BU1521GVW upscales and interpolates images when upconverting to the HDTV (Maximum 1080P) format from the usual SDTV
(NTSC/PAL) format.
High quality IP changeã»up scale management is realized by the frame memory less operate.
It is the LSI which is the most suitable for the compact system of the mobile.
â Features
1ï¼Input format
480i or 576i(ITUR BT656) YCbCr 4:2:2(ITUR BT601) 8bit Digital Interface
2ï¼Output Format
480i or 576i(ITUR BT656) YCbCr 4:2:2 8bit Digital Interface
480p or 576p(SMPTE 293ã»ITUR BT1358) YCbCr 4:2:2 16bit Digital Interface
1080/59.94i(SMPTE 274) YCbCr 4:2:2 16bit Digital Interface
1080/50i(SMPTE 274) YCbCr 4:2:2 16bit Digital Interface
1080/59.94p(SMPTE 274) YCbCr 4:2:2 16bit Digital Interface
1080/50p(SMPTE 274) YCbCr 4:2:2 16bit Digital Interface
3ï¼IP conversion function
Conversion function from interlace to progressive
4ï¼Upscale function
Horizontal direction: 720 pixels pass-through or upscaling to 1920 pixels
Vertical direction: up scaling to 480, 576, 540, and 1080 pixels
5ï¼Filter function
5 Ã 5 filtering function over input data
Filter coefficient is programmable with registers
6ï¼Register access
Register read/write through the SPI interface
Burst write/read support
7ï¼Built-in PLL
Input frequency 27MHz
Output frequency 74.25MHz,74.175824MHz,148.5MHz,148.351648MHz
8ï¼Power-down mode and through-mode support
Power-down mode can be controlled through STBY pin or register setting.
Through-mode can be selected by register setting.
9ï¼Supply voltage
VDD(core voltage )1.15Vï½1.25VãAVDD(PLL)=2.7V~3.3Vã
VDDIO1(SDTV input)=1.7Vï½3.6VãVDDIO2(control)=2.7Vï½3.3Vã
VDDIO3(HDTV output)=1.7Vï½1.9V
10ï¼Package
63 pin, BGA package (SBGA063W060, Size = 6 mm à 6 mm, 0.65 mm pitch)
â Aplications
Digital Video CameraãDigital still camera , Video game, a portable DVD
